ARR was built for subscriptions with a fixed contract value, and consumption pricing breaks the assumption underneath it. There is still a defensible ARR figure for a usage-based business. Producing it means deciding which dollars are recurring, choosing an annualization window, and holding both decisions constant across periods so the number stays comparable to itself.

Can you calculate ARR when pricing is usage based?

Yes. Annualize the contracted floor, then add the portion of usage revenue that has proven it recurs.

``` Usage-Based ARR = Annualized Platform Fee + Annualized Committed Minimum + Normalized Recurring Overage ```

Take an account paying a $60,000 annual platform fee with usage billed monthly on top. Trailing twelve month usage billings total $84,000, of which $18,000 came from a one-time data migration in March. Recurring usage is $66,000, so ARR is $126,000.

A more conservative version counts only what the customer is contractually obligated to pay. If the committed usage minimum is $48,000, contracted ARR is $108,000 and the remaining $18,000 sits in a run rate line. Both numbers are defensible. Publishing one figure in a board deck and the other in a diligence file is not.

Which usage revenue belongs in ARR?

Recurring obligation belongs in ARR, and everything event-driven belongs outside it.
Revenue componentIn ARRMethod
Platform or subscription feeYesContract value annualized
Committed usage minimumYesCommitment annualized
Overage that recurs month after monthYes, normalizedTrailing average annualized
Usage spike from a one-time eventNoExclude and note separately
Free credits, trials, or pilot consumptionNoNo contractual obligation
Professional services and implementationNoNot recurring revenue
The judgment call is the third row. A customer whose overage has run between $4,000 and $6,000 every month for a year has a run rate. A customer with one $30,000 month and eleven quiet ones has an event. Set a rule, such as overage present in at least nine of the last twelve months, and apply it to every account rather than case by case.

Which annualization window should you use?

Match the window to the shape of the account's consumption.
WindowCalculationBest forRisk
Latest monthMonth x 12Flat, mature consumptionOne heavy month projects a full year of peak
Trailing 3 monthsAverage x 12Accounts growing steadilyPicks up quarter-end surges
Trailing 12 monthsTotal, adjusted for one-timeCustomers with seasonal cyclesSlow to reflect a real step change
Committed minimum onlyContract floorConservative external reportingUnderstates the true run rate
Consumption follows the customer's own business cycle, so a retail customer peaks in Q4 and a tax software customer peaks in Q1. Annualizing either one from their peak quarter creates ARR that will visibly evaporate the following period. The trailing twelve month window absorbs that cycle at the cost of reacting slowly to genuine growth. Sales seasonality compounds the problem on the bookings side. In our data, Q2 and Q4 usually run stronger than Q1 and Q3, and the third month of a quarter runs stronger than the first two. Building a run rate from a quarter-ending month picks up both the customer's cycle and the seller's cycle in a single inflated number.

How do you handle contracts with commitments plus overage?

Count the commitment as contracted ARR and treat sustained overage as expansion in the waterfall.

A customer who commits to $100,000 and consumes $130,000 is a $100,000 contracted account producing $30,000 of expansion. When that overage persists across periods and the customer raises the commitment at renewal, the expansion converts into contracted ARR with no change to what they actually pay.

That conversion is worth tracking on its own. Sustained overage is the strongest renewal signal a usage-based business has, since the customer has already demonstrated the demand the higher commitment would formalize. Accounts consuming below their commitment are the inverse signal, and they show up as contraction at renewal rather than as churn.

How does churn appear in a usage-based model?

As declining consumption, months before any cancellation event.

Subscription churn is binary and dated. Usage churn is gradual, so a business waiting for cancellation notices sees the erosion after it has already cost a year of revenue. Measure each account against its own trailing baseline and treat a sustained decline as contraction in the net revenue retention calculation.

Support activity adds a second signal. In ORM customer data, accounts with no support cases at all are at churn risk, as are accounts with seven or more in a year. Three to five cases, usually tier 2 or tier 3, indicates an engaged customer. Pairing that with a consumption trend line identifies at-risk accounts while a renewal conversation can still change the outcome.

How do you forecast usage-based ARR?

Forecast consumption per account and roll it up, rather than applying a growth percentage to a total.

A blended growth assumption across a usage-based base averages accounts that are scaling with accounts that are winding down, and the average hides both. Account-level projection surfaces concentration, which matters more here than in a subscription model because a single large consumer can swing the total.

The forecast also has to update as conditions change. Consumption responds to the customer's own volume, and their volume responds to their market. That is the same reason a revenue forecast built on last year's assumptions misses, and the reason a usage-based ARR figure needs a rebuild cadence rather than an annual review. Frequently Asked Questions

Can you calculate ARR with usage-based pricing?

Yes. Annualize the contracted platform fee plus the committed minimum, then add the portion of overage that has recurred for long enough to count as a run rate. Usage that appeared once and stopped belongs outside ARR, reported as a separate line so nobody builds a plan on it.

Should overage revenue be included in ARR?

Only the sustained portion. Take a trailing window, remove any one-time event that drove a spike, and annualize what remains. An account with 84,000 dollars of trailing usage that includes an 18,000 dollar migration burst has 66,000 dollars of recurring usage, and the burst gets excluded.

Which annualization window works best for usage revenue?

Trailing three months multiplied by four for accounts with steady growth, and trailing twelve months for accounts whose consumption follows their own business cycle. Latest month times 12 is the fastest to compute and the easiest to distort, since one heavy month projects a peak across the whole year.

How do you report ARR when the customer has no commitment?

Report it, and label it separately from contracted ARR. Uncommitted usage revenue is real revenue with no contractual floor, so it belongs in a run rate line rather than in the same total as signed commitments. Boards and buyers treat those two dollars differently, and mixing them costs credibility in diligence.

How does churn work in a usage-based model?

Churn shows up as declining consumption long before a cancellation, so the binary churn event arrives late. Track consumption decline against each account's own baseline and treat a sustained drop as contraction in the ARR waterfall, which is where a usage-based business sees erosion first.
